Vintage Persian Karaja Runner: 1930s Mirrored Tribal Samovar Design
Discover the captivating geometry and rare symbolic motifs of this hand-knotted Persian Karaja runner. Dating to the 1930s, this vintage masterpiece showcases a meticulously balanced composition and a sophisticated "cool-toned" palette. At nearly 15 feet in length, it serves as a commanding architectural element for grand hallways and galleries.
Mirrored Symmetry & Hidden Tribal Symbols
This runner features a single column of alternating medallions arranged in a mirrored end-to-end patterning, providing a rhythmic and harmonious visual flow. The main field is densely ornamented and reveals delightful "hidden" details upon closer inspection, including scattered animals and serpents—ancient tribal symbols of protection and the natural world.
The framing is exceptionally detailed, featuring:
Samovar & Sampler Motifs: The main, inner, and outer borders are composed of meandering vines and "Samovar" germinating plant designs, a classic Northwest Persian motif.
Cool Industrial Palette: A refined selection of Dusty Teal, Jade Green, and Dusty Powder Blue, grounded by Charcoal, Oxidized Silver, Chestnut, Ivory, and Cream.
Expertly Restored Vintage Integrity
This 1930s textile has undergone professional conservation to ensure it remains a functional and beautiful centerpiece for decades to come.
Refined Texture: Displays even wear across to the knot heads with a faint foundation showing through, offering a soft, low-profile patina that is ideal for high-traffic corridors.
Professional Conservation: To ensure longevity and visual consistency, this piece features multiple areas of professional repile. The sides have been machine bound for modern stability, and all ends are fully secured.
Pristine & Ready: Recently professionally cleaned, this rug is sanitized and ready for immediate in-home use.
Product Specifications
Origin: Hand-knotted in Persia (Karaja)
Era: Circa 1930s Vintage
Dimensions: 2'11" x 14'8"
Construction: 100% Hand-Knotted Wool
With its unique serpent motifs and a rare "oxidized silver" and teal palette, this Karaja runner is a sophisticated choice for those seeking a rug that balances tribal history with a modern, cool-toned aesthetic.
